Water pressure should be maintained between 25 and 75 psig (1.7
and 5.2 bar), but not to exceed 145 psig (10 bar).
Water piping to and from the compressor unit must be a
minimum of 1 inch diameter. Isolation valves with side
drains should be installed on both input and return lines.
Input water should have a 2 mm strainer installed in-line.
A normally closed solenoid valve should be connected to
the water outlet of the compressor. The compressor con-
trol circuit switches this circuit. Consult the Sullair Service
Department for assistance in these setups.
Water quality is critical to proper cooling of the compres-
sor. Excessive build-up of lime, scale or other deposits
can restrict the flow of water to the compressor. These
deposits act as a thermal insulator and reduce the effi-
ciency of the water cooler.
The cleaning of piping and water coolers is the cus-
tomer's responsibility. Inspect all piping for deposits and
clean as necessary. Refer to Section 4.2.5: Water quality
recommendations on page 56.

Do not install a water-cooled or an air-cooled/after-
cooled compressor where it will be exposed to tempera-
tures less than 32°F (0°C). Consult factory for machine
operation in ambient temperature less than 32°F (0°C).

Temperature and pressure gauges should be installed in
the water piping for use in troubleshooting of the water
system. Water pressure should ideally be between 25
and 75 psig (1.7 and 5.2 bar) but must not be above
145 psi (10 bar).
4.2.3

Water system venting

Vent the system upon installation or after draining the
system on start-up:
1. Open the water valve(s) allowing water to flow to
the system.
2. Open the vent cocks (located on top of the after-
cooler and the lubricant cooler) and allow all air
to escape from the system. When water is
observed at the vent cocks, close them.
The system is now vented.
